Minibeast Positional Language
28th Apr 2026
Today the children created a minibeast hotel, and placed the bugs according to a set of instructions. The children had to listen to the positional language (right, left, beside, on top, behind, underneath, inside and outside) and draw their bug in the correct spot. Ash class were all able to identify the location of the bugs in the hotel, showing good spatial awareness and logical reasoning skills - vital for mathematical development. The children then used Numicon to create butterfly and snail pictures.
